After breakfast, get transferred to Kalimpong, which is a distance of approximately 75 km and takes 3 hrs. It is a scenic drive through a quiet hill town known for orchids, monasteries, and colonial charm. On arrival, check in to your hotel and after freshening up proceed for local sightseeing. We start with Deolo Hill, which is definitely the highest point of Kalimpong. The views from Deolo Hill are mesmerizing and on clear days will bring you pictures of the mighty Kanchenjunga Ranges that will continue to be etched in your minds for your lifetime. The other points that may be covered are Dr. Graham’s Home, Durpin Monastery, Pine View Nursery and Mangal Dham Temple. Durpin Monastery is also known as Zang Dhok Palri Phodang. This peaceful prayer hall has a combination of the views of the serene and winding Teesta along with gorgeous Kanchenjunga ranges. Pine View Nursery is unique of its kind that seldom meets your eyes. It houses an extraordinary collection of cacti and succulents and these unique species are arranged in a greenhouse setting. The nursery will amaze all plant lovers and photography enthusiasts, and the oldest ones can be traced to be about 75 years old. The entry fees are nominal and you can grab some tasty snacks and drinks inside the facility in a beautiful mountain setting. Afterwards come back to the hotel and enjoy a peaceful evening with views of the Himalayas. Dr. Graham’s Home will interest historians more than ordinary tourists. It was founded in 1900 by Reverend Dr. John Anderson Graham and this sprawling educational complex was aimed at offering care and schooling for the underprivileged Anglo-Indian children. It has a feel both nostalgia and inspiration. Mangal Dham Temple is the seat of peace, devotion, and spiritual grace and is a revered sightseeing spot of Kalimpong. Overnight stay at Kalimpong.
